GSU Announces Excellence Awards and Grants Tenure


University Park, IL–(ENEWSPF)– Governors State University recently honored members of its faculty and staff with awards acknowledging their excellence as educators and employees. The awards recognize the hard work and dedication of those who share the university’s commitment to its students and the community.

“Each year awards are given to people who have demonstrated outstanding achievements in teaching or the performance of primary duties, research or creative activities, and/or service,” explained Dr. Jane Hudak, Provost of Governors State University. “The award publicly acknowledges the good work accomplished by the university’s faculty and staff throughout the year.”
